Employee injures hamstring while bracing cart

Employee #1 was manually pulling an overloaded Global metal utility cart, trying to steer it around a rubber mat on the floor. The cart began to tip, and she injured her hamstring while trying to brace the cart to keep it from falling over on her. The thin wheel base, the excess load, and the fact that she was pulling and not pushing the cart, all contributed to its instability.
